    Cases that go to trial

    Mesothelioma lawsuits can be a bit complicated, but many claims reach settlement agreements before going to trial. However, if a case does go to trial the jury will decide how much compensation the victim is entitled to. A trial verdict can also be appealed, which may delay any compensation payments for months or years.

    Personal injury lawsuits make up the majority of mesothelioma compensation cases filed in the United States. They seek financial compensation to cover medical expenses, lost wages, and other costs. The money from a mesothelioma lawsuit will not bring back health or a loved one. But it can help the victims, their families and the legal system to receive the best possible care.

    The discovery phase can last for months while attorneys gather evidence and speak with witnesses. A mesothelioma lawyer will interview current and former workers who may provide valuable information on asbestos exposure. The lawyer will also gather medical records to prove that asbestos exposure caused mesothelioma. At this point, a client may be required to give depositions that are recorded and played to a jury in the event of a trial.

    Wrongful death claims seek compensation for the loss of a loved one to mesothelioma or any other asbestos-related disease. These lawsuits seek justice by holding the responsible parties accountable for negligently exposing victims to asbestos. The claims for wrongful death are filed by spouses, children or other relatives of a loved one who has passed away.

    A mesothelioma law firms attorney can assist victims to determine the amount of compensation they are eligible to receive. Compensation from a mesothelioma lawsuit can include economic, non-economic, and punitive damages. Economic damages include payments for future and past medical expenses, lost wages, and funeral costs. Non-economic damages include suffering and suffering as well as loss of consortium and emotional distress. Punitive damages are a kind of punishment that seeks to discourage asbestos companies from engaging fraudulent or oppressive practices, or committing grossly negligent actions.

    Additionally, mesothelioma lawyers can assist victims and their families in filing lawsuits for wrongful deaths. Wrongful Death claims are comparable to personal injuries lawsuits, and seek compensation for a loved one's loss due to asbestos exposure. These claims can be filed by spouses, children or other relatives of asbestos victims.
